    A senior Chinese general has for the first time officially confirmed that the country is building an aircraft carrier. According to experts and media reports, the vessel is the half-built Soviet warship Varyag, which China bought and is completing. The ship is not ready yet, Colonel General Chen Bingde, head of the People's Liberation Army (PLA) general staff said in an interview with Hong Kong Commercial Daily. His aide Lieutenant General Qi Jianguo said the ship, when it is ready, will serve as a floating training camp for Navy pilots. It will not be sent on missions to territorial waters of other countries "unlike some other nations do," the general said.
